You can change an old-fashioned key at your local auto dealership or locksmith. The process of a dealership may take a bit of time, and the locksmith service is generally cheaper. Based on the model and make the locksmith for your car can also assist you in programming the new key to work with your vehicle's lock system. You'll need evidence of ownership, such as a registration certificate or title, though. Some locksmiths will make you new keys on the spot while others require you to bring your vehicle back to their shop. It could take between 20 minutes and an hour.

Transponder Keys

A lot of cars built after the '90s have transponder chips in the key to prevent car thieves from hot wiring your car. If you lose your key with chip, it's crucial to get it replaced immediately because the car won't start if it isn't.

It's actually quite simple to accomplish if you've got the spare key - you can take the spare to an auto locksmith and have them copy the key replacement for car for you at a cheaper price than the dealer would charge. If you're looking to save some cash then you can do it yourself. However, the process is more complicated and requires some understanding to do right.

The key can serve as a replacement for the ignition, however it won't work to start the engine. It will not replace the ignition, as you will require the transponder in order to signal the immobilizer system in your car key replacement service to start the motor.

The chip in the key transmits a radio frequency signal to the immobilizer at time it is inserted into the ignition cylinder. The immobilizer makes sure whether the chip's code matches the code it needs to start the vehicle. If the chip on the key doesn't match the one in the key, the engine will stay at a standstill and won't move.

A professional can program a new key for your vehicle by sending an indication to the chip in the key that is in line with the code on the immobilizer. The technician can then delete the key that was previously used from your vehicle's system, so that it will only accept the new key as a valid and working device.

Transponder chips can be added to your key in two ways: either as a blade that must still be placed into the ignition, or as an integrated chip that remains on the key fob. The cost of transponder keys will be more expensive than a regular key. However the added security and convenience that the chip offers is worth the extra expense.
